is there a word for daily or weekly anniversaries?

0

Your difficulties in your search may stem from the fact that the Roman calendar did not have weeks as we know them. However, since the Romans went around conquering people who did use weeks, they seem to have come up with at least one Latin word that I could find that expresses the concept: hebdomas, hebdomadis, a word that persists in later Latin, where Holy Week is Hebdomada Sancta and a hebdomadarius is one who performs certain duties within their order for the week. On the basis of my research, then, I propose the awful mouthful hebdomadariversary, although it’s quite possible that someone with more formal knowledge of Latin may be able to correct me on the proper formation of such a word.
